The video tutorial explains the three ways to pronounce the ED suffix in regular English verbs: as a T sound, an ID sound, or a D sound. It emphasizes the importance of focusing on the final sound of the infinitive rather than the spelling. The tutorial introduces IPA symbols for sound representation and provides rules for applying each pronunciation. It also offers tips for improving pronunciation by using dictionaries to check the final sounds of verbs.
